Output 2a7f8887feff17438abfd51cdb2309dd786491c91208bce27a14d357be346276:1

value
15956195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e507b99be7920d179d84dd9ce08ff2e72b2f293b OP_EQUAL
address
3Na1vDaqmgN9MgRKJc54TbZ53KQLLkKE1k
transaction
2a7f8887feff17438abfd51cdb2309dd786491c91208bce27a14d357be346276
confirmations
180838
spent
true